Sounds a good result. We do need to be careful about what and how much we expect P2P to do as from the looks of things they are an international organisation. Now that is fine but we may not be able to flow grant monies to them..

Niki P checked with AHRC and their response was that an international company could participate in ‘mutually beneficial’ hub based activities that were badged under the heading of ‘international cooperation’ and paid for using the grant.  The reciprocity would arise from the fact  the company might be making a contribution to the project (indirectly) through their participation and bringing new knowledge/expertise into the arena. However, it would not be possible to pay an international company for other goods and services or enter into a contracting/sub-contracting relationship on a one-to-one basis using AHRC grant monies.

Of course that was with respect to them being a company… are they? Before we can get definitive advice from AHRC can you confirm what type of organisation they are and in what capacity you would expect them to be involved?
